The Directorate of Enforcement (ED) has conducted search operations at multiple locations in Mumbai as part of an ongoing investigation into Varanium Cloud Limited, its promoter Harshavardhan Sabale, and related companies. This action follows allegations that the company misused funds raised through its Initial Public Offering (IPO) in September 2022.
Varanium Cloud Limited had raised approximately ₹40 crore from its IPO, stating the funds would be utilized for establishing edge data centers and digital learning centers in smaller towns. However, ED officials claim that these promised projects were never brought to fruition. Instead, the funds were allegedly diverted through fabricated transactions and circular movements. The purpose of these complex financial maneuvers, according to the ED, was to artificially inflate the company's turnover and market value, misleading investors and the market.
This development raises serious concerns about corporate governance and the integrity of financial reporting for companies going public. Investors in such companies can face significant losses if funds are misappropriated and business plans are not executed as stated.
